This readily explains why many X-linked disorders never affect women. For example ... WebRed-green color vision defects are the most common form of color vision deficiency. This condition affects males much more often than females. Among populations with Northern European ancestry, it occurs in about 1 in 12 males and 1 in 200 females. WebJun 26, 2024 · Males have 1 X chromosome and 1 Y chromosome, and females have 2 X chromosomes. The genes that can give you red-green color blindness are passed down on the X chromosome. Since it’s passed down on the X chromosome, red-green color blindness is more common in men. This is because: Males have only 1 X … WebThis disorder affects about 8% of men and about 1% of women. Sufferers are unable to tell the difference between red and green. Tests like the image below are used to test for this disorder.
